| - I won't make this super long. After living in India for over a year before moving to Toronto I have been on the hunt for great Indian food in my new city. Lots of people told me to go to little india and try Lahore Tikka House. While I enjoyed Lahore, I found it super oily and more akin to Pakistani food than Indian.
Banjara is the opposite, very fresh, not crazy oily, and far more Indian. Look, this place is not a 5 star restaurant, so don't go in expecting one. However, the prices are super reasonable, the food is amazing and fresh, and it makes the whole area smell AWESOME!
In particular, I love the Paneer Makhani...I haven't had it that good since a hill station in northern India that still haunts. That meal still haunts my dreams.
Go in with reasonable expectations, and enjoy a nearly authentic Indian meal.
